Farooq Abdullah Urges Workers to Strengthen Party at Grassroots, Slams Centre Over Voter List Issue in Bihar

Kulgam, July 8 : National Conference (NC) President Dr. Farooq Abdullah on Tuesday addressed party workers at Rest House Chawalgam, where he urged them to strengthen the party at the grassroots level.

Speaking at the gathering, Dr. Abdullah said that party workers are the backbone of the NC and their efforts on the ground are crucial for the party’s future. “You must stay connected with the people and make the party stronger from the grassroots,” he said.

He also criticized the central government over recent developments in Bihar, alleging that an unusually high number of voters have been added to the voter list.“The way the central government has manipulated the voter list in Bihar is unconstitutional and unacceptable,” he said.

Dr. Abdullah further said that the people of India have started to recognize the “real face” of the BJP. “Because the public is seeing through their agenda, they are resorting to unconstitutional means just to hold on to power,” he added.

Senior NC leaders including Sakina Itoo, Nasir Aslam Wani, and several party workers were also present at the event.(KNS)
